Default Does anyone remember St. Joseph School in Holy Trinity, AL?

I attended St Joseph School in Holy Trinity, AL for elementary school until the late 80's. I moved up north for high school & college. Upon a visit with relatives about 2 years ago, we decided to drive out to Holy Trinity (about 25 miles outside of Phenix City on hwy 165) for old times sake, to see if the school was still open. It looks like it is some kind of senior center now. Does anyone know what happened or why the school closed down? I loved that school, & was just curious to what the story is behind it not being open anymore.
